Understanding Printing Paper Types
Printing paper comes in various types, each specifically developed for various applications. Below is an in-depth breakdown of the most typical types of printing paper.

The weight of paper is measured in grams per square meter (GSM) or pounds (pound). The greater the GSM or poundage, the thicker and more substantial the paper. Here are some typical weight classifications:

Choosing the best printing paper involves thinking about numerous elements to ensure the very best outcomes. Here are some crucial considerations:

Purpose of the Print: Understand what you are printing and for whom. Business reports might require various paper than marketing brochures.

Type of Printer: Inkjet and printer have various compatibilities with paper types. Constantly inspect compatibility to avoid jams or bad printing quality.

Finish: Decide between shiny, matte, or textured finishes based on the desired aesthetic and performance.

Color vs. Black and White: Color prints frequently look better on glossy or semi-gloss documents, while black-and-white prints might acquire a timeless appearance on matte or textured documents.

Tips for Storing and Handling Printing Paper
Proper storage and handling of printing paper can maintain its quality. Consider the following pointers:

Store in a Climate-Controlled Environment: Extreme humidity or dryness can warp paper. Keep it in a cool, dry space.

Avoid Direct Sunlight: Prolonged exposure to sunshine can cause fading and staining.

Avoid Stacking Too High: Excess weight can cause bending or warping. Shop in flat stacks when possible.

Manage with Clean Hands: Oil and dirt from hands can impact the paper quality. Always manage with care.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. What is the very best type of paper for printing photographs?
Shiny paper is typically preferred for printing photos, as it boosts color and contrast for a lively finish.
2. Can I use recycled paper in a laser printer?
Yes, a lot of recycled paper is compatible with printer. Nevertheless, it's important to examine for the advised weight and density.

4. What weight of paper should I utilize for service cards?
For business cards, heavyweight paper (around 250-300 GSM) is suggested to make sure resilience and an expert feel.
5. How do I choose paper for pamphlets?
Select a paper type that stabilizes quality and spending plan. Midweight text paper is frequently ideal, providing a good feel while being cost-effective.
